5203 |a“An investigation has been undertaken into the determination of tin in the certified reference materials, MP-1 and KC-1, by the titrimetric and atomic absorption methods. The effect of the nature of the metal used to reduce Sn(IV) to Sn(II) in the titrimetric method has been evaluated. It has been shown that there is no significant difference between the results obtained by the titrimetric method when properly applied and those obtained by the atomic absorption method using the standard additions technique. The mean value for tin in MP-1 and KC-1 by both methods are 2.43% and 0.683% respectively. The value for MP-1 is lower than the recommended value"--Abstract, p. i.
